The source code to get the ambiguous time offsets is given below. The given program is compiled and executed successfully.
using System;
using System.Globalization;
using System.Collections.ObjectModel;
class TimeZoneInfoDemo
{
//Entry point of Program
static public void Main()
{
DateTime ambiguousTime;
TimeZoneInfo timeZone1 = TimeZoneInfo.FindSystemTimeZoneById("Central Standard Time");
TimeZoneInfo timeZone2 = TimeZoneInfo.FindSystemTimeZoneById("UTC");
ambiguousTime = new DateTime(2007, 11, 4, 1, 0, 0);
if (timeZone1.IsAmbiguousTime(ambiguousTime))
{
Console.WriteLine("Time is ambiguous");
TimeSpan[] ts = timeZone1.GetAmbiguousTimeOffsets(ambiguousTime);
Console.WriteLine("Ambiguous time offsets: ");
foreach (TimeSpan t in ts)
{
Console.WriteLine("\t" + t);
}
}
else
Console.WriteLine("Time is not ambiguous");
if (timeZone2.IsAmbiguousTime(ambiguousTime))
{
Console.WriteLine("Time is ambiguous");
TimeSpan[] ts = timeZone2.GetAmbiguousTimeOffsets(ambiguousTime);
Console.WriteLine("Ambiguous time offsets: ");
foreach (TimeSpan t in ts)
{
Console.WriteLine("\t" + t);
}
}
else
Console.WriteLine("Time is not ambiguous");
}
}
Output:
Time is ambiguous
Ambiguous time offsets:
-06:00:00
-05:00:00
Time is not ambiguous
